Capacity Gaps for Housing Stability for Veterans in Nebraska
Nebraska faces significant capacity gaps in providing adequate housing support for veterans, with many individuals grappling with homelessness or unstable living situations. According to the 2020 Nebraska Point in Time Count, over 1,000 veterans experienced homelessness on a single night, highlighting an urgent need for expanded housing solutions in the state. Despite the presence of various programs aimed at assisting veterans, infrastructure and resource challenges persist, hampering their effectiveness.
One of the major constraints in Nebraska’s capacity to serve veterans lies in the inadequate availability of affordable housing options. With rising rental prices and limited supply, many veterans find themselves in precarious situations, often needing multiple services such as mental health support and job training to stabilize their living conditions. Furthermore, geographic disparities leave rural veterans particularly vulnerable, with limited access to essential services and supportive networks compared to their urban counterparts.
The Housing Stability for Veterans program aims to address these gaps by providing funding specifically targeted toward creating stable living environments for homeless veterans. The initiative encompasses comprehensive supportive services, including housing assistance, job training programs, and mental health counseling tailored to meet the unique needs of Nebraska’s veterans. By integrating these services, the program seeks to ensure veterans can transition into stable homes and regain their independence.
Implementation of this program involves collaboration between state agencies, local housing authorities, and non-profit organizations specializing in veteran services. This collaborative model is imperative for providing robust support and ensuring that veterans receive the assistance they need in a coordinated manner. Additionally, the program will institute metrics for assessing housing outcomes to ensure accountability and adapt strategies as needed, ultimately leading to successful transitions for veterans into sustainable living.
In essence, the Housing Stability for Veterans program is a strategic response to the capacity challenges faced by Nebraska in supporting its veteran population. By deploying targeted resources and fostering partnerships, the initiative seeks to enhance the quality of life for veterans across the state, paving the way for lasting stability.
